Illuminati in Brazil: An Overview
Illuminati Brazil, the concept of the Illuminati has transcended its historical roots in Bavaria to become a
global phenomenon, with various interpretations and associations, including in Brazil.
While the original Bavarian Illuminati was a secret society found in 1776 by Adam Weishaupt,
modern references to the Illuminati often involve conspiracy theories, secret societies, and cultural myths.
Here’s a detailed look at the presence and perception of the Illuminati in Brazil.

Modern Interpretations in Brazil
- Conspiracy Theories: Many Brazilians subscribe to various conspiracy theories that involve the Illuminati. These theories often suggest that the Illuminati is involve in global events, including political upheavals, economic crises, and cultural shifts. The idea that influential figures in politics, entertainment, and business are part of a secretive elite is a common theme.
- Social Media and Online Communities: The rise of social media has facilitated the spread of Illuminati-related content in Brazil. Various online communities discuss and promote theories about the Illuminati, often sharing videos, articles, and memes that contribute to the mystique surrounding the organization.
- Scams and Fraud: There have been reports of scams in Brazil that exploit the allure of the Illuminati. Scammers often pose as members of the Illuminati, promising wealth and power in exchange for personal information or financial contributions. These scams have been report globally, including in Brazil, where individuals are targeted through social media and email.

Criticism and Skepticism
- Skeptical Views: While many Brazilians are fascinated by the idea of the Illuminati, there is also a significant portion of the population that views these theories with skepticism. Critics argue that the belief in the Illuminati often distracts from real social and political issues, reducing complex problems to simplistic narratives of conspiracy.
- Academic Perspectives: Scholars and researchers in Brazil have studied the phenomenon of conspiracy theories, including those related to the Illuminati.
- They often emphasize the psychological and sociological factors that contribute to the popularity of such beliefs, including the need for explanations in times of uncertainty.
